Industrial & Engineering Chemistry Research, Vol.42, No.26, 6962-6969, 2003
Temperature dependence of a modified Pitzer equation for strong electrolytes systems
We have established the temperature dependence for a modified Pitzer model. This model adequately correlates osmotic and activity coefficient data together with the dilution enthalpy for single-electrolyte solutions. For multisalt aqueous solutions, the modified model can successfully predict the behavior of the osmotic coefficient and the enthalpy at different temperatures. For the new model, the total average percentage error in the osmotic and activity coefficients is 3.1%.
